International Marketplace
This massive store near the Strip is a global treasure trove with food from over 50 countries. Shoppers love finding imports they thought only existed overseas. You could spend hours here and still not discover every aisle’s hidden gem.

Rani’s World Foods
This Indian market in Las Vegas is compact but packed with spices, lentils, frozen meals, and hard-to-find ingredients. It’s a go-to for authentic flavor without the high markup. Once people find it, they guard the secret tightly.
